It was on a summer's morning, When flowers were a-blooming, O When meadows were adorning And small birds sweetly tuning, O I met my love near Banbridge Town, My charming blooming Sally, O And she is the crown of County Down, The Flower of Magherally, O. With admiration I did gaze Upon this blooming maiden, O Adam never was more struck When he first saw Eve in Eden, O Her skin was like the lily white That grows in yonder valley, O And I think I blest when I am nigh The Flower of Magherally, O. Her yellow hair in ringlets fell, Her shoes were Spanish leather, O, Her bonnet with blue ribbons strung, Her scarlet scarf and feather, O.
